In the classroom
Teaching tips & learning objectives
Learning objectives
Students will use the printed reference to memorize multiplication facts from 1×1 through 12×12.
Students will locate a specific multiplication fact quickly using the three-tables-per-page column layout.
Teaching tips
Because every product is already printed, use this as a take-home study reference or in-class lookup chart rather than as a graded worksheet.
Post individual columns as a quick-reference wall chart for students still building fluency with a specific table.
Pair this reference with a blank multiplication drill so students practice recall before checking their answers against the printed chart.
